void Actors::updateEquippedLight (const MWWorld::Ptr& ptr, float duration)
|
||||
{
|
||||
//If holding a light...
|
||||
MWWorld::InventoryStore &inventoryStore = MWWorld::Class::get(ptr).getInventoryStore(ptr);
|
||||
MWWorld::ContainerStoreIterator heldIter =
|
||||
inventoryStore.getSlot(MWWorld::InventoryStore::Slot_CarriedLeft);
|
||||
|
||||
if(heldIter.getType() == MWWorld::ContainerStore::Type_Light)
|
||||
{
|
||||
// ... then use some "fuel" from the timer
|
||||
float timeRemaining = heldIter->getClass().getRemainingUsageTime(*heldIter);
|
||||
|
||||
// If it's already -1, then it should be an infinite light.
|
||||
// TODO see what happens for other negative values.
|
||||
if(timeRemaining >= 0.0f)
|
||||
{
|
||||
timeRemaining -= duration;
|
||||
|
||||
if(timeRemaining > 0.0f)
|
||||
heldIter->getClass().setRemainingUsageTime(*heldIter, timeRemaining);
|
||||
else
|
||||
heldIter->getRefData().setCount(0); // remove it
|
||||
}
|
||||
}
|
||||
}
